Gazza Just got back home for a night before Hotlicks and myself head over to "Glesga" for tomorrow night's show

The Stones put on what I thought was a pretty solid performance. To be honest, any arena concert following last Friday's wonder show at Wembley is always going to suffer by comparison but for anyone seeing the band for the first time this tour,I'm sure they'd have been delighted by what they got.

No real surprises in the setlist apart from the running order (there was NO "classic album" theme and "You got me rocking" was switched to a middle part of the show,where it fits better instead of being played near the beginning,a place I dont think it merits). It worked well. A bit of a surprise to get both "Sympathy" and "YCAGWYW" in an arena - both went down a treat. they used the "freeway" backdrop for "YCAGWYW" thats normally used for slow tracks like "love in vain" or "wild horses". Strange that they soundchecked "Wild horses" and then failed to play it - maybe we'll get it on wednesday.

I had floor tickets and figured I'd have to be very early to get a decent place. I was doubly surprised to get into the venue at 7.15 pm to find that not only was there a b-stage (after all the talk for the last couple of months that this would not be the case) but that I was easily able to walk right up to Keith's side and position mysel;f at the corner of the b-stage with just one person between myself and the barrier. wasnt even that much of a crush at all later on when the band DID come down for the mini-set.

A very enthusiastic crowd (more so than London) and in good humour (Mick congratulated them on their singing by saying "you could hear that all the way back in Edinburgh - which generated good natured boos at the mention of the capital city...!)

I've never liked the venue I have to admit and its a pity such a great concert city doesnt have a better one. yes, its pretty big but the sightlines from the side arent great (its very wide instead of being long) and the sound bounces a lot. Where I was it wasnt TOO bad once the show got going after a few songs, but some of the press reports this morning seemed to suggest there were problems. No fault of the Stones' though this time,it has to be said.

Fantastic thrill to see the band so close on the b-stage and NOT be almost crushed to death in doing so. Seeing them
play "Mannish Boy" from six feet away on a small stage just blew me away and gave me all these "Wish I was there" visions of the Crawdaddy club, the El Mocambo or the Checkerboard Lounge. Keith's expressions were worth the ticket price alone. During IORR he started looking a bit pissed and started admonishing Pierre and the crew in front of the stage as he couldnt hear himself. For a minute or so he was inaudible and the look he shot Pierre would probably have provoked a lesser man to commit hari-kiri. I swear, I've never seen an expression like that in my life. You'd kill to be able to pull a look like that on anyone. Its something that you couldnt replicate if you spent a lifetime in front of a mirror pulling "tough guy" poses. You'd have sworn that his eyes just disappeared inside his head. Of course,a minute or so later he turns that on its head by turning to the crowd in bemusement, shrugging his shoulders and grinning as if to say "so what?" in a way which would have endeared him to anyone. He then hit the first chord of "Brown sugar" WAY before the rest of the band were ready and then almost keeled over laughing. A microcosm of moods and emotions Keith-style in the space of five minutes. Oh yeah,and he WAS playin his ass off,I hasten to add. If that guy's fingers are crippled by arthritis, I'll have ten like them, thank you very much.

As I said earlier it was a fine performance - no complaints at all. They nailed CYHMK as always, "Nearness of you" was gorgeous, even the much maligned "you got me rocking" sounded fresh and nasty.

Gazza oh yes, and a bit more:

1) Respectable was on the setlist as the first song on the b-stage. They played Mannish Boy instead.

2) Mick didnt sing at the soundcheck. Bernard did,as is sometimes the case.

3) for those of you wondering where the Stones are staying in Glasgow - they're not. according to this morning's paper, they're in Edinburgh, staying at the Balmoral Hotel (same hotel they used when they played Edinburgh in 1999)

kahoosier I enetered the arena after standing in line most of the day and pretty much had the choice of where I wanted to be. I could have been two people away from the main stage Keith side, but almost did that at the Enmore and Astoria( LOL with all the pushing at the theaters, there were more in front of me but I bet the distance wasn't much different!)There was still room at the bar up front on Ronnie's side near the back up singers. But what surprised me is though people had lined up along the cat walk, no one had stood up to the b-stage yet. I took front and center. It was wonderful. I saw Gazza to my right and we gave each other thumb's up.
After Wembley, is is pretty hard to compare this show. I mean it was great, but Wembley was so outstanding. Keith did have some troble during its IORR, and I agree with Gazza on the looks he gave, but Pierre was on it and within a few bars was up fiddling with monitors and solved the problem.
Everyone keeps talking about Respecatble being replaced. From where I stood, I could see the set list in the B-stage guitar box and on the technicians desk in front of me, and from the beginning on those lists the B-stage set started with Mannish Boy. I don't doubt it was a cahnge though, as the tech cut small lists up and taped them inside the towels that he placed strategically around the b-stage so everyone could open them and play the same song I guess. This kind of thing may explain some of the false starts we hear about now and then , I mean what if you are the band memember that doesn't wipe his face and know there has been a last minute change LOL .

Watching Keith from that distance has finally convinced me that a lot of tha bad boy image is that...just image. The man did not appear intoxicated, but does have a serious love affair going on with his guitar. It was a hoot when he false started BS and had to stop and wait on the band! Anyhow, after 25 years and four concerts and God knows how much money, I have finally been front row center at a Stones show...what a life!
